Brain injuries can have life-changing impacts on people of all ages, but this is perhaps more keenly felt among younger people. 1,415 children aged 0-15 suffered a traumatic brain injury according to the most recent NHS statistics for 2019-20, with 583 young adults aged 16-25 also experiencing this type of injury.
